How they compare

India currently reports 11.28 million against 10.33 million in China, a difference of 946,500.

That makes India's figure about 1.1 times China's.

The two have swapped places 3 times across 25 shared years of data; in 1990 it was China ahead.

China ranks 2nd and India ranks 1st of 191 countries.

Across the 3 decades both report, China averaged higher in 2 and India in 1.

Head to head by decade

Decade China India Difference Ahead
1990s 11.98 million 7.76 million 4.23 million China
2000s 9.64 million 9.52 million 121,505 China
2010s 10.66 million 10.83 million 174,240 India

Averages of every year both report within each decade.
